Bridgman growth of Cs2LiYCl6:Ce and 6Li-enriched Cs26LiYCl6:Ce crystals for high resolution gamma ray and neutron spectrometers
چکیده انگلیسی

Single crystals of small and large diameter Cs2LiYCl6:Ce and 6Li-enriched Cs26LiYCl6:Ce have been grown by the vertical Bridgman technique. These scintillator crystals are used in the fabrication of high resolution, gamma ray and neutron spectrometers. The Cs2LiYCl6:Ce and 6Li-enriched Cs26LiYCl6:Ce crystals we have grown have high light outputs of up to ∼22,000 photons/MeV. The emission wavelength for the Cs2LiYCl6:Ce and 6Li-enriched Cs26LiYCl6:Ce is λ=373 nm. This material has an excellent energy resolution at room temperature of ∼4% FWHM for 662 keV photons (using a super bialkali photomultiplier). Cs2LiYCl6:Ce exhibits different temporal responses to gamma and neutron radiation. This difference results in effective pulse shape discrimination. In this paper, we will report on our results to date for vertical Bridgman crystal growth and characterization of Ce-doped Cs2LiYCl6:Ce and 6Li-enriched Cs26LiYCl6:Ce crystals.
